Jose Mayo, Director of Business Development

Jose Mayo

Director of Business Development

 

Value Delivered

Jose helps clients obtain the operations, maintenance, mobile, and site-based facilities services they need to for high-performance operation and smart facilities management. He also educates current clients about the many ways in which Building Technology Engineers (BTE) can improve their maintenance and operations strategies. After listening to a client’s issues and challenges, he develops the estimates, proposals, and other paperwork necessary to start projects that enable clients to achieve their goals. He also coordinates other EMCOR companies and resources when they are needed to fully satisfy a client’s requirements. Throughout the process, he seeks to build long-term relationships by developing value-added solutions that exceed clients’ expectations, while delivering an ongoing return on their facilities investment.

 

Expertise

After serving as a utility systems operator with the United States Air Force, Jose joined BTE as a stationary engineer/HVAC mechanic, eventually becoming an assistant chief engineer. He then held positions as project manager and operations supervisor respectively with Johnson Controls. From Johnson Controls, he moved to Cushman & Wakefield as a campus manager and then, to Jones Lang LaSalle, where he was a senior facility manager. Before returning to BTE, he was a senior facility manager with EMCOR Facilities Services.

 

Jose holds a bachelor’s in business management from the University of Phoenix. He has also taken courses in the Air Force technical schools, Peterson School of Steam Engineering, Johnson Controls Institute, and Bay State Institute of Technology. In addition, he has participated in BOMA’s Facilities Management Administrator (FMA) course and the International Facilities Management Association’s (IFMA’s) Certified Facilities Manager (CFM) program.

 

A member of the Association for Facilities Engineers (AFE) and an associate member of the American Society of Heating, Refrigeration, and Air-Conditioning Engineers (ASHRAE), he holds air conditioning refrigeration licenses in Massachusetts and Rhode Island, a Massachusetts stationary engineer’s license, and a universal CFC (chlorofluorocarbon) certification.
